# Break-Glass: Catalog Cache Invalidation

Scope: the Pinrow product catalog at Veldstone Retail. If stale prices persist after a purge and the Hollowmere invalidation queue is wedged, use break-glass to flush the edge tier directly. Contractors: get verbal sign-off from the catalog lead first. Steps: open the Hollowmere admin shell, select emergency-flush, confirm the tenant, and run it once — repeated flushes thrash the origin. Access is logged and expires after 20 minutes. Unseal the admin shell with the passphrase below.

recovery phrase for kahop-tajog: istix-casvan

Ticket: Staging env misconfigured for Siftgate bloom filter

The bloom layer in front of the Pellet KV store is rejecting all lookups in staging because the env file was copied from the dev template without credentials. False-positive tuning values are fine; only the auth line is missing. To unblock the weekly demo, the Pellet admission secret must be set on the following line.

env line for yaguf-fajop: LEDGER_TOKEN13=fb08984397349

// Broker upgrade notes for plugin authors:
// Quillbus 4.x replaces the legacy 3.x wire protocol. Plugins must
// construct the client with explicit protocol negotiation enabled,
// or connections to the Larkfield cluster will be silently downgraded
// and dropped after 30s. Topic names are unchanged. For local testing
// against the sandbox broker, authenticate with the key below.

API key for bafof-bagaf: qvz2-qi

Handover note — Marla to Devi

The roof-terrace door at Harwick House has been jamming all week, usually after rain. Push firmly at the top-left corner while turning the handle; don't force the latch or it wedges completely. Brellan Maintenance is due Thursday to plane the frame. Until then, prop the door only with the rubber wedge from the reception drawer, never the fire extinguisher. If anyone gets stuck outside, the override keypad by the stairwell will release it. Enter the following pass code on the keypad.

staff pass of kawip-hawef = bdg-QLP-2